List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ange, Russel Metals is one of the largest metals distribution and processing companies in North America servicing customers primarily in Canada and the United States. The company conducts business in three metals distribution segments: metals service centers, energy products and steel distributors.

We are currently seeking a highly motivated and results oriented individual for the position of Internal Auditor in our Mississauga (Corporate Office) location. The Internal Auditor is tasked with providing Senior Management, external auditors and the Board of Directors with an independent assessment of the internal control environment and the effectiveness of control procedures. This will be accomplished by executing the audit projects defined in the annual audit plan.

Job Requirements and Qualifications:

  • Perform scoping, data analytics and sampling for each audit.
  • Perform audit procedures including documenting auditee processes and procedures, reviewing and analyzing evidence, and identifying and defining issues.
  • Communicate the results of the audit to management in closing meetings and provide recommendations for any issues identified
  • Prepare working papers to support auditing results for Manager review. Ensure all coaching notes are cleared and issues documented in the audit software
  • Drafting of the audit report and presenting to the Manager and Director for review.
  • Conduct follow up testing to ensure recommendations were appropriately implemented and the issue corrected.
